Output d374f63e07766d0368dd016f6d1307347506e5717d144e762c2148b5aca3e6ad:1

value
414000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873a9c29b301a6c9113f824394f660e40760268e OP_EQUAL
address
3E23Mjdc9rVTHEX13W3qxS141cFvbF7wxA
transaction
d374f63e07766d0368dd016f6d1307347506e5717d144e762c2148b5aca3e6ad
confirmations
410029
spent
true